Output f3aff24055ee9a7518c6d6aaa2717bbe2a03087a1cd96ea1c3ee08fc47d35eba:0

value
4046515
script pubkey
OP_0 OP_PUSHBYTES_20 feee8f8639922e985589b86fa052b36e2d5913b9
address
bc1qlmhglp3ejghfs4vfhph6q54ndck4jyaesnryra
transaction
f3aff24055ee9a7518c6d6aaa2717bbe2a03087a1cd96ea1c3ee08fc47d35eba
confirmations
42872
spent
true